public abstract class TCAMessageStatusPersister extends Object
Constructor and Description |
---|
TCAMessageStatusPersister() |
Modifier and Type | Method and Description |
---|---|
static co.cask.cdap.api.dataset.DatasetProperties |
getDatasetProperties(int timeToLiveSeconds)
Create TCA VES Message Status Table Properties
|
static void |
persist(TCACEFProcessorContext processorContext,
co.cask.cdap.api.flow.flowlet.FlowletContext flowletContext,
TCACalculatorMessageType calculatorMessageType,
co.cask.cdap.api.dataset.lib.ObjectMappedTable<TCAMessageStatusEntity> messageStatusTable)
Saves Message Status in Table.
|
static void |
persist(TCACEFProcessorContext processorContext,
co.cask.cdap.api.flow.flowlet.FlowletContext flowletContext,
TCACalculatorMessageType calculatorMessageType,
co.cask.cdap.api.dataset.lib.ObjectMappedTable<TCAMessageStatusEntity> messageStatusTable,
String alertMessage)
Saves Message Status in Table.
|
public static void persist(TCACEFProcessorContext processorContext, co.cask.cdap.api.flow.flowlet.FlowletContext flowletContext, TCACalculatorMessageType calculatorMessageType, co.cask.cdap.api.dataset.lib.ObjectMappedTable<TCAMessageStatusEntity> messageStatusTable)
processorContext
- processor ContextflowletContext
- Flowlet ContextcalculatorMessageType
- Calculation Message TypemessageStatusTable
- Message Status Tablepublic static void persist(TCACEFProcessorContext processorContext, co.cask.cdap.api.flow.flowlet.FlowletContext flowletContext, TCACalculatorMessageType calculatorMessageType, co.cask.cdap.api.dataset.lib.ObjectMappedTable<TCAMessageStatusEntity> messageStatusTable, @Nullable String alertMessage)
processorContext
- processor ContextflowletContext
- Flowlet ContextcalculatorMessageType
- Calculation Message TypemessageStatusTable
- Message Status TablealertMessage
- Alert messagepublic static co.cask.cdap.api.dataset.DatasetProperties getDatasetProperties(int timeToLiveSeconds)
timeToLiveSeconds
- Message Status Table time to live in secondsCopyright © 2017. All rights reserved.